Memphis Woman Charged for Possessing Over 50 Pounds of Marijuana at City's International AirportSource: Shelby County Sheriff’s Office

A 21-year-old woman, Kierra Carter, was charged after more than 50 pounds of marijuana were discovered in her suitcase at Memphis International Airport on Sunday, Memphis Police reported. The significant find has put Carter at the center of a felony drug possession case with the intent to distribute.

The stash was stumbled upon after a United Airlines employee spotted her luggage burst open on a baggage cart, revealing vacuum-sealed bags containing the illicit substance, according to WREG. Confirmation that the luggage belonged to Carter was made, and she consented to a search, which led to the substantial marijuana confiscation,

The officers on the scene found 56 pounds of marijuana, which later tested positive for the controlled substance. Upon verification that the bags bore Carter's name tags, the Memphis Police Department proceeded with her apprehension and charge. The affidavit mentioned by Local Memphis details how Carter was charged with possession of a controlled substance with the intention to manufacture, deliver, or sell.
